What is Saxenda?
Saxenda (liraglutide) is a once-daily injectable prescription medicine used for weight loss and weight maintenance. It mimics a hormone in the body called GLP-1 (glucagon-like peptide-1), which targets areas of the brain that regulate appetite. This results in a reduced feeling of hunger and helps you eat fewer calories.
Saxenda is approved for use in adults with a BMI of 30 or higher, or adults with a BMI of 27 or higher who also have weight-related medical issues such as high blood pressure, type 2 diabetes, or high cholesterol.

The Best Saxenda Injection Sites
There are three recommended areas on the body where Saxenda can be injected:
- Abdomen (Stomach Area)
This is the most common site. You should inject Saxenda at least two inches away from your belly button. - Thighs
You can use either the front of your left or right thigh. Make sure to rotate legs daily. - Upper Arm
The back of the upper arm is also an approved area. However, this site may require assistance unless you are very comfortable with injections.
When rotating injection sites, avoid injecting into the same exact spot within the same week. Repeated injections into the same location can cause lumps, irritation, or poor absorption.
Tips for Choosing the Right Site
- Choose an area with some fatty tissue.
- Avoid sites that are bruised, tender, hard, or scarred.
- Rotate sites daily to prevent tissue damage.

How to Inject Saxenda: Step-by-Step Technique
Mastering the Saxenda injection sites and techniques means knowing how to administer the injection properly. Here’s a clear step-by-step guide:
1. Wash Your Hands
Always begin with clean hands to prevent infections.
2. Prepare the Pen
Remove the cap and check the liquid in the pen. It should be clear and colorless.
3. Attach a New Needle
Always use a new needle. Peel off the protective seal and screw it onto the pen.
4. Do an Air Shot (Prime the Pen)
Before the first use each day, hold the pen with the needle facing up. Turn the dose selector to 0.6 mg and press the dose button. A small drop should appear at the needle tip.
5. Select the Dose
Use the dose selector to set the amount prescribed by your doctor.
6. Choose and Clean the Injection Site
Pick a site from the approved areas. Clean it with an alcohol swab and let it dry.
7. Inject the Medication
Hold the pen like a pencil and insert the needle into your skin at a 90-degree angle. Press and hold the dose button until the dose counter returns to 0. Keep the needle in place for 6 seconds to ensure full delivery.
8. Remove and Dispose of the Needle
Carefully remove the needle and discard it in a sharps container. Replace the pen cap.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Reusing Needles: Always use a new needle each time to prevent contamination and dullness.
- Skipping Rotation: Repeating the same injection spot can damage tissue.
- Improper Dosing: Double-check your dose before injecting.
- Not Priming the Pen: This step ensures the pen works correctly and delivers the full dose.

Managing Side Effects at Injection Sites
Mild side effects at the injection site can occur. These may include:
- Redness
- Swelling
- Itching
- Bruising
To minimize these effects:
- Use a new needle every time
- Rotate your injection sites
- Apply a cold pack to the site after injection if needed
If irritation persists or worsens, consult your healthcare provider.
Traveling with Saxenda
If you’re traveling within the United States or abroad, keep the following in mind:
- Store Saxenda in a refrigerator until first use.
- After the first use, you can store it at room temperature (below 86°F) for up to 30 days.
- Carry your pen in a travel case or insulated bag.
- Always bring extra needles and your prescription.
